Today is the beginning of a huge extravaganza-- Fashion Night Out. It started in New York by Vogue magazine to stimulate the economy and boost sales for retailers. The results were remarkable. It was epic and dreamy for the shoppers to have a night of splurging on fashion obsessions-- and mingling with celebrity designers. Now, Los Angeles wants a piece of the action.
